AI-07: Stabilize resolver behavior in the Quillgate edge fleet.

Root cause: resolver cache thrashing under burst load caused intermittent NXDOMAIN for internal services during the Fernvale deploy. Fix adds a pinned fallback resolver and jittered retries; merged, pending release train inclusion. Owner: Dasha. Verify by running the lookup soak test for 24h on staging. No config migration required; constants ship with defaults. The agreed resolver timeouts and cache bounds follow below.

tuning constants:
QUOTAS = {
    "druwyn": 5,
    "holix": 5,
    "zorath": 5,
    "holwyn": 10,
}

02:14 — Nightly search reindex on Quellbase stalled after the tokenizer shard ran out of heap. The scheduler retried twice, then marked the job failed and paged on-call. Marisol confirmed the document backlog was intact and no partial index was promoted to serving. Root cause traced to an oversized synonym file merged earlier that day. Rollback of the synonym bundle restored the run by 03:40. The failing run is identified by the trace token below.

pipeline stamp: htk31_f769b577b3028a4e9958e5bb8d1259a

During the spring exam window, the Examhold proctoring queue starved low-priority review tasks for six hours because the priority comparator ignored enqueue time. The fix introduces an aging factor so stalled items gradually gain priority. As the reviewer, please verify the comparator change against the fairness test suite and confirm the aging coefficient matches the agreed value. The design discussion, chosen parameters, and test expectations are written up on the internal page below.

runbook for tagef-tagef: https://confluence.qorvelcorp.internal/display/browse/view/67670d0e2976

# Who to Ping: Spokewise Rebalancer

Welcome aboard! Spokewise is the tool that decides which vans move bikes between docks overnight. Day-to-day questions (weird suggestions, stale dock data) go to the rebalancing squad's channel — someone's usually around. Model tuning belongs to Priya's forecasting group; don't file those as bugs. If a city operator reports vans getting sent to closed docks, that's urgent and skips the normal queue. For anything urgent or if the channel is quiet, email the squad directly here.

alerts address for kajog-tadup: druox@plorvanet.internal